This year’s BNP Paribas Taste of Tennis benefited the Food Bank For New York City, which provides 68 million pounds of food annually to more than 1,000 emergency and community food programs — including soup kitchens, food pantries, shelters, low-income daycare centers, kids cafes and senior, youth, rehabilitation and outreach centers — throughout the five boroughs of New York City. The Food Bank helps provide 250,000 free meals a day for New Yorkers who otherwise would go hungry or not eat enough, who are largely comprised of women and children, the elderly, people with disabilities and the working poor.

About BNP Paribas and Tennis
This year BNP Paribas celebrates the 36th anniversary of its partnership with tennis. Since 1973, BNP Paribas has been actively involved in this great sport, regularly increasing its support locally and internationally for professionals and amateurs alike, including families, schools and the community. Over the years, BNP Paribas has become the world’s number 1 tennis sponsor. The bank has been the official sponsor of Roland Garros for 36 years, title sponsor of the Davis Cup since 2001, the Fed Cup since 2005 , the BNP Paribas Masters since 1986 and the Internazionali BNL d’Italia since 2006. The bank actively supports numerous other international competitions such as the WTA Bank of the West Classic in California and the Monte Carlo Masters Series.
In the United States, BNP Paribas is the title sponsor of the BNP Paribas Open, also known as the Grand Slam of the West in Indian Wells, California, and of the BNP Paribas Showdown in Madison Square Garden in New York City.

Sparks, MD – Fila USA announces that it will debut its Fall 2009 Tennis Heritage Collection on Fila’s world class athletes slated to compete at the US Open at the Arthur Ashe National Tennis Center in New York beginning on August 31, 2009. The collection is inspired by Fila’s extensive archive of Italian designed product and features Fila’s iconic red, white and peacoat blue colors and cutting edge performance fabrications and cuts. Marin Cilic, Dmitry Tursunov, Anna Chakvetadze, Janko Tipsarevic, Agi Szavay and the other Fila players will wear the new collection for the Grand Slam tournament along with Fila’s Alfa performance tennis shoes, a modern complement to the classic style of the Heritage collection.
In a clear contrast to flashy contemporary lines, the Heritage collection will surely set Fila’s athletes apart as the company’s design team seeks once again, to pay homage to Fila’s great achievements in world-class tournament play. Fila’s history as a leading innovator in tennis apparel that has been worn by some of the game’s greatest names over the last 35 years is an ever-present inspiration to Fila designers. Solids accented by bold, contrasting stripes dominate this year’s look with several pieces featuring flag-like diagonal stripes, which are a clear nod to Fila’s design cues from the early 70’s.
This season’s integrated collection for women has an old school appeal that combines classic Fila styles with performance design details like the Heritage Skort in white and peacoat, a new player’s skort that is now pull-up rather than wrap-around. Utilizing the excellent performance and draping qualities of Fila’s flat poly Spandex jersey material, the designs for tops offer a v-neck cap sleeve for a feminine covered shoulder look and two sleeveless cuts: an open racerback tank, and a sleeveless polo with narrow 5-snap placket – both with mesh inserts on the back for added venting. All three tops, in solid colors and contrast trim around the neck and arms, beautifully complement both skort colors. The white Heritage dress with wide, solid red shoulder straps and contrasting red/blue trim is drop waist. New emphasis has been put in
the women’s Heritage warm-up jacket and pant with high knit collar and a pant waist that incorporates Fila’s Personal Performance flattering yoga pant designs.
The men’s Heritage collection in bold contrast colors offers six integrated pieces with three tops, a longer, elastic waist short in white and peacoat, and a cotton poly knit warm-up jacket and pant. The short sleeve polo with Fila’s signature printed window pane design and rounded drop tail is the highlight of the collection. There are also two short sleeve crew neck tops. One features bold red and peacoat blue trim on a white body and the other, a stripe insert short sleeve, features the flag-like diagonal stripes so tastefully integrated in the women’s line. The solid men’s pant in peacoat with white side seam trim and bottom leg zipper, is complemented by the bold red and peacoat jackets that have a truly eye catching Italian contrast knit taping design.
Adorned with the embroidered F-box Heritage patch logo to clearly define the special line, the 100% polyester and poly/cotton/spandex blended fabrics used in this season’s Heritage collection offer unsurpassed performance attributes to insure optimal comfort, ventilation and moisture wicking.
